Longines has launched its first boutique in Thailand, nestled in the heart of Chiang Mai, the vibrant and charming hub of Northern Thailand. The grand opening featured notable figures, including Pornthep Attakijpaisarn, General Manager of Central Chiang Mai; Weerachote Thirawayamakul, Head of Regional Marketing at Central Pattana Public Company Limited; Mathurot Suthanyarak, Marketing Manager at Central Chiang Mai; Thaphat Kulsirinun, Longines Brand Manager; and Kris Bhimayothin, Swatch Group Thailand Country Manager. The boutique is strategically located on the first floor of Central Chiang Mai, a prominent shopping centre in the region.

The official launch on 26 August 2024 brought together watch enthusiasts, collectors, and key personalities from Northern Thailand. Inspired by aircraft runways, the event celebrated Longines' rich history, inviting guests to explore the brand's world of horological expertise, including pioneering innovations like the first flyback and GMT watches. Spanning 142 square metres, the boutique is meticulously designed to showcase the brand's creations and long-standing heritage.

The core values of Longines are reflected in a sleek, elegant, yet welcoming environment that proudly displays a selection of finely curated timepieces. The interior blends contemporary materials like steel and glass with the warmth of dark wood and the iconic navy-blue palette, echoing the brand's universe.
